Perfect Zucchini Noodles Every Time
To make perfect zucchini noodles (a.k.a. zoodles), use a spiralizer or julienne peeler for long, even strands. Toss them gently in a hot pan just long enough to warm them through—overcooking can result in watery, mushy noodles. The key is a quick sauté with olive oil, garlic, and fresh lemon juice for bright, punchy flavor that enhances but never overwhelms the delicate fish.
Cooking Halibut to Perfection
For moist, flaky halibut, season fillets lightly with salt and pepper and sear them in a hot, oiled skillet. Cooking just until the fish is opaque and easily flakes with a fork ensures a succulent result. A final squeeze of lemon over the top boosts freshness and ties the whole dish together.

Instructions
- Pat halibut fillets dry and season both sides with salt and pepper.
-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add halibut fillets and cook for 3-4 minutes per side, or until golden and just cooked through (fish should flake easily with a fork). Remove from skillet, cover loosely with foil, and set aside.
- Wipe the pan clean and add remaining 1 tablespoon olive oil. Add minced garlic and sauté for 30 seconds until fragrant.
- Add spiralized zucchini to the skillet. Toss gently for 2-3 minutes until just tender but not soggy.
- Stir in lemon zest and juice. Season with salt and pepper, and toss to combine.
- Divide zucchini noodles among plates. Top each with a halibut fillet and sprinkle with fresh herbs.
- Garnish with extra lemon wedges if desired. Serve immediately.

Cook and Prep Times
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 10 minutes
Total Time: 25 minutes
